    Turns out, Flau’Jae Johnson was only teasing a music-related collaboration and had zero intentions of going through the transfer portal, unlike what was initially rumored.

    In one of his recent videos, NCAA analyst Robin Lundberg talked about the rumored transfer of LSU star Flau’Jae Johnson. While it was eventually revealed that it was not the case, the analyst talked about how Johnson could have taken advantage of social media to get the most engagement as possible.

    “The transfer portal and social media are a good combination for confusion, right?” Lundberg said. “Flau’jae Johnson posted on social media, ‘4 out,’ and people are wondering, ‘What exactly does that mean?,’ because she had previously said she was not going into WNBA Draft. So, the assumption is she’s returning to LSU.”

    “She seems to have a great relationship with Kim Mulkey. But when Flau’jae teases a major announcement on social media, fans are like, ‘What’s going on?,’ when that said announcement also has a ‘four out’ message next to it, and she talks how great LSU has been for her. Now, I full expect Flau’jae to return to LSU.”

    With these things said, Lundberg explained it in a straightforward manner: it was intentional and for the simple reason of getting the most engagement as possible.

    “I don’t think she is transferring or anything like that. But, it felt like the post was a little bit purposefully cryptic in order to gain maximum attention for whatever said major announcement is.”

    The NCAA Transfer Portal is a digital database that allows student-athletes to explore transferring to other schools by notifying their current institution and entering their name into the system. It streamlines the transfer process, enabling athletes and coaches to connect more efficiently while adhering to NCAA rules and eligibility requirements.
